(Hockey) Podium players warned not to take their places for granted

KUALA LUMPUR: The door to the national men’s hockey team is always open.

Despite the presence of 24 players from the elite Podium Programme, national coach Stephen Van Huizen said other aspiring players will still be considered.

As such, those who shine in the Malaysian Hockey League which starts on Wednesday, will be considered for selection to the national team.

In the same breath, Stephen said the 24 Podium players are not guaranteed of a place in the national team.

“Before the national training camp took a break, I have told the national players not to take it easy.

“The players in the national team need to maintain their form as there are others in the league who want to prove to the coaches that they deserve to be selected.”
